Penelope Cruz in Engagement Ring Bling?



A kuckle-sized sapphire and diamond ring was spotted on Penelope Cruz's ring finger at the New York Film Festival this weekend, but the actress refused to confirm the significance of the stunner, according to People Magazine.

As if impeccable genes, an uber-successful career and and Oscar weren't enough, Cruz has the audacity to get super sexy, Javier Bardem, as her longtime love and possible husband. It's a cruel, cruel world, jewelry hounds.

Despite my unattractive feelings of jealousy, I am loving the idea of the non-traditional engagement ring making another star appearance (Princess Diana made the sapphire engagement ring famous back in the day and the trend continues to this day).



Many couples are opting for colored gemstones instead of the traditional diamond these days. They not only make a unique statement, they're often less pricey than their diamond counterparts - especially if you opt for a treated gemstone. Good news for us all, right?

Khloe Kardashian's Engagement Ring Bling


Well, jewelry hounds? I found the Khloe Kardashian diamond ring low down for you.

The wedding that has everyone in Hollywood buzzing went down yesterday evening between Khloe and her LA Laker bf, Lamar Odom - and of course Ryan Seacrest was there to film the fiesta for his Keeping Up With The Kardashians reality show (why that show gets ratings is beyond me).

Actually, I do see at least one angle of interest here. Khloe's whopper of a diamond engagement ring was finally spotted, and the 9-carat radiant cut bauble rivals that of fellow Laker wife, Vanessa Bryant (wife of Kobe).

While Vanessa lost in the carat count (she has a mere 7) she does win the dating game - hanging with Kobe for a marathon 6 months before walking down the aisle. Way to take your time, ladies.

The Hunt for a Perfect Diamond


Diamonds are associated with the finest things in life, and a diamond engagement ring is possibly the most significant diamond purchase that you will make during your lifetime. Browsing jewelry stores and catalogs can be overwhelming, with each one guaranteeing that they offer the best quality selection. So how can you be sure that you are getting a great diamond in that designer ring
Finding the perfect beautiful ring for the woman that you love can be a difficult job if you don’t know what you are looking for. When you propose you want her to know that only the finest, superior quality diamond ring is good enough for her, and you should also take care to find a designer ring that suits her style and taste to make the ring more personal. When it comes to diamonds size matters, but is only a part of what you should look for in an engagement ring. The physical size, or weight, of a diamond is measure in carats, but just because a diamond is large doesn’t mean that it is high quality, or even attractive. In fact, many of the largest stones that you see on display in jewelry counters may not even be real, or natural diamonds.
To truly appreciate a diamond you need to take into consideration the other 3 ‘c’s of diamonds, namely cut, clarity and color. The finest diamond designer rings will display exquisite cuts, a high level of clarity, and a pure color. However, if you are looking for a cheap engagement ring you can opt to choose a higher grade of one element over another to keep the price of your designer ring within your budget. For example, if you are happy with a diamond that has flaws ‘only visible under close inspection’ then you will be able to afford a larger carat. A diamond with a cut that is not quite perfect might be technically less valuable but could create an unusual fire and sparkle to enhance the clarity of the gem. Each piece of diamond jewelry that you purchase should come with a certificate to show you exactly what the rating is for each ‘c’. The beauty of buying a diamond designer ring online is that a good site will often display that useful information right alongside each beautiful ring.
Some may even let you search by settings for your engagement ring, by diamond type or by price range letting you find a precious engagement rings within your budget. Modern designer rings now also offer choices in other gemstones for engagement rings in tantalizing color combinations such as diamond and tanzanite rings or pink saphire and diamond rings. Settings for engagement rings can also vary, ranging from modern designer styles to classic and traditional settings. The important this is to choose a diamond ring not based on size or price alone, but to choose a designer ring that you feel she will love and treasure forever, because that is was an engagement ring symbolizes.
